Amrita Jhaveri Vs DCIT (ITAT Mumbai) Non-Resident Assessee Exempted from Disclosing Overseas Assets in Indian Income Tax Return, ITAT Quashes Re-Assessment Order. The Amrita Jhaveri Vs DCIT case, heard by the Income Tax Appellate Tribunal (ITAT) in Mumbai, pertained to the requirement of non-resident individuals to disclose overseas assets in their income tax returns filed in India. The ITAT ruled that such disclosure was not mandatory for non-residents and quashed the re-assessment order issued by the Assessing Officer.
